Leucanella Silk Moth
Leucanella contempta windi

Description:
This is a female of yet a third Io Moth-like species in San Cristobal. The hind wings are dark grey with an eye spot surrounded by black and yellow. There is both brown and red phenotypes. The last picture shows the normal resting position of the moth. Family Saturniidae.

Habitat:
Came to an ultraviolet light in the garden, San Cristobal de Las Casas, 2,200 meters. The last 3 pictures are of a slightly redder specimen photographed on 14 May 2013 in the same place.
